Drag and drop tabs between two windows

Currently, tabs can be dragged and dropped to reorder them, but they cannot be dragged between windows. With other terminals, there are two useful variations of this behaviour:

  • Dragging a tab off a window to create a new window.
  • Dragging a tab into another window to dock it.

Neither of these currently work with the Windows terminal.
